Burns Llama Trailblazers
Burns Llama Trailblazers raises Ccara llamas in Burns, Oregon, Harney County and the High Desert near Bend. The ranch has focused on careful breeding for over a decade and follows recommended herd health guidelines from national llama associations.
Each animal lives on open pasture among native grasses and daily social interaction helps them stay calm on trail outings. They maintain health testing with vaccinations, parasite control, and routine veterinary care overseen by experienced local veterinarians. Shearing each spring yields a soft fleece ideal for crafts and fiber art projects.
The farm’s approach includes early handling and gentle training so the llamas adapt to working livestock and family environments, with access to shelter and shaded resting areas. Visitors often note their friendly demeanor, steady temperament, and willingness to engage with handlers. Their gentle nature makes them a popular choice for family farms, educational programs, and community demonstrations.
